I was actually a double record - the most runs from an over & the most sixes hit in an over in first class cricket, Canterbury's Lee Germon scored an incredible 77 runs, including 8 sixes, from a single over. Mind you, the bowler bowled 17 no balls, which is probably a record too... Over to you.

Anything to do with the Miss Fiji beauty contest? The winner had expected to be in the Miss Universe contest in Mexico in November but was told that she wouldn't be due to claims that the vote had been rigged.
Yes the real winner was an indiginous Fijian.... and she won when the corruption was spotted over to you
Am not sure that's accurate actually - the corruption came to light after the second winner was announced. The owner of the company licenced to hold the competition turned out to be her husband, who, it seems, had promised her she would win, and changed the voting rules when she didn't. And she isn't really Fijian either - was born in Sydney, Australian father/Fijian mother. Then the Miss Universe organisation stepped in and handed the title back to the original winner...
